Car was acting up so I took it to Steve Lewis who also deals with Volvos.They gave me new brake pads and rotors but the car was worse than before.On 7/23 I was out shopping when car began to act up. Car was not driving smoothly.Car would tremble as I drove and as I would be stopped at traffic light. Very scaryI went to Steve Lewis Subaru/Volvo ( now in Hadley on Rte. 9) because they were so close by and I had bought car there when it was Performance Motoring.It took them 4 hrs. before they could look at it. Then they test drove it. CHECK ENGINE light was on,but, they ignored it. It was on when I left there.They Came to me and said brakes needed rotors and pads. I trusted them and okayed the work which took about 1 and 1/2 hrs. more. I saw them test drive it again and I know that that mechanic felt it was still not fixed because after I paid the bill($534.49) and got in to start it the trembling was MUCH worse than before. I went in and got [redacted] to come out and start it. He said the trembling would disappear as I drove it.I knew this was a lie, but, I had been there so long and I was very tired. I have MS and because the weather was so hot and humid that day I just wanted to get out of there. They were not going to fix it properly.I took a chance driving to [redacted] in [redacted]. I was very worried that the car would break down and I'd be stranded in that heat. The car drove terribly, but, I made it just before closing. I had to leave it.The next day [redacted] knew right off the problem had to do with the ignition coils and they fixed it properly. The bill was $577.34.The problem was NOT the brakes and the Steve Lewis people knew it,but, I guess because I'm a female senior ciizen they could get away with this and I'd accept it quietly.And I really don't even know if they did the brake work as I had no problems with them before.Desired SettlementI would at least like a refund on the labor cost.Business' Initial Response Contact Name and Title: [redacted]Contact Phone: [redacted] ext [redacted]Contact Email: [redacted]The customer called the local consumer protection agency. We worked out a resolution as follows:The customer has a service credit of $200.00 towards any parts or service at Steve Lewis Subaru(not to expire). The resolution was agreed upon during a 3 way call with the [redacted], The consumer protection agency and Steve Lewis on 8/15/2013. The reason for the service credit in lieu of a refund was the customers description of the original complaint of : "Customer states vibration when braking test drive and advise". we verified the customer concern and replaced the front brakes and front rotors to correct the issue. At the time we had no idea that the vehicle had a vibration issue at idle.
